What is the impact of federal funding cuts on scientific research at Harvard University?

Federal funding cuts can significantly destabilize scientific research at Harvard University. With over $2 billion in federal grants frozen due to governmental disputes, research initiatives in crucial areas like science, medicine, and technology may suffer. This disruption not only jeopardizes ongoing projects but could also stifle future innovations that are vital for U.S. economic growth.

What long-term economic effects could result from a freeze in federal funding for research?

The long-term economic effects of freezing federal funding for research could be profound. Experts project that even a partial cut could shrink the U.S. GDP by about 3.8%, reminiscent of the challenges faced during the Great Recession. This decline reflects not only immediate funding constraints but also the reduction in innovative startups that emerge from research-driven universities like Harvard.

Why is federal funding for scientific research critical for the U.S. economic growth?

Federal funding for scientific research is critical for U.S. economic growth as it facilitates breakthroughs that can be transformed into commercial products. Studies show that for every dollar spent on federal biomedical research, there is a return of $2.56 in economic activity. This funding thus represents an investment in future technologies and industries vital for maintaining the nation’s competitive edge.

How can the impact of federal funding cuts on research be reversed and what is the expected timeline?

Reversing the impact of federal funding cuts on research will require a concerted effort to restore grants and support to laboratories. The timeline for recovery could span one to three years, as the process of transitioning lab innovations into market-ready startups is inherently gradual. Immediate actions to reinstate funding could alleviate some negative effects, but broader recovery will be essential for long-term economic revitalization.
